API de Personalização
Métodos do UnicoThemeBuilder
| Método | Descrição |
|---|---|
setColorSilhouetteSuccess(color) | Cor da silhueta quando a captura é bem-sucedida |
setBackgroundColor(color) | Cor de fundo do frame de captura |
setColorText(color) | Cor do texto |
setBackgroundColorComponents(color) | Cor de fundo dos componentes de UI |
setColorTextComponents(color) | Cor do texto dentro dos componentes de UI |
setBackgroundColorBoxMessage(color) | Cor de fundo da caixa de mensagem |
setColorTextBoxMessage(color) | Cor do texto dentro da caixa de mensagem |
setBackgroundColorButtons(color) | Cor de fundo dos botões |
setColorTextButtons(color) | Cor do texto dos botões |
setColorCancelButton(color) | Cor do botão de cancelar |
setColorProgressBar(color) | Cor da barra de progresso |
setFontFamily(font) (v3.19.2+) | Família de fonte para o frame de captura |
setHtmlPopupLoading(html) | HTML personalizado para o popup de carregamento (somente captura de documento) |
build() | Retorna a instância de UnicoTheme |
Tipos de valor de cor
Os tipos de cor suportados são strings hexadecimais (ex.: "#FF0000").
Locale
| Método | Tipo | Descrição |
|---|---|---|
setLocale(locale) | LocaleTypes | Define o idioma da tela de captura |
Consulte Referência de API > Enums para a lista completa de valores LocaleTypes suportados.